  • Logan Day: Cut loose by Edmonton

    Day won't receive a qualifying offer from the Oilers, which means he'll become an unrestricted free agent Friday.

    Day was passable in the minors this season, picking up 16 points while racking up 53 PIM in 48 games, but he's already 26 years old, and clearly isn't part of Edmonton's plans for the future. He'll hope to land a two-way deal with another organization.

  • Oilers' Logan Day: Sent down to minors

    Day (hand) was activated off non-roster injured reserve and reassigned to AHL Bakersfield on Thursday.

    Day suffered an injury during training camp, which required him to start the year on injured reserve. With the blueliner healthy, he will link up with the Condors. Last season, the 25-year-old registered seven goals and 27 helpers with Bakersfield and will likely need to wait at least another year before getting his chance to break into the NHL.

  • Oilers' Logan Day: Will go under knife

    Day will undergo hand surgery, Mark Spector of Sportsnet.ca reports.

    Day's timeline for recovery still isn't clear, but it's likely he'll miss the rest of the preseason. Since he can't be sent down to minors while injured, he may begin the season on the Oilers' injured reserve until he's healthy again.

  • Oilers' Logan Day: Suffers undisclosed injury

    Day is currently dealing with an undisclosed injury, Jim Matheson of the Edmonton Journal reports.

    Until cleared to play, Day can't be sent down to the minors, which means he could start the year on injured reserve if his problem lingers. Once given the green light, the blueliner will link up with AHL Bakersfield, where he'll likely spend the bulk of the year.
